Study on the Effectiveness of Interaction in Blog to Blogger's Loyalty

Blog writing has made a great leap forward in China in recent years, but a critical challenge faces its service providers that how to ensure blog writers'loyalty to a particular platform so as to use it continuously. Therefore, this thesis focuses on blog, analyzes interaction between bloggers and their readers, their satisfaction with a particular platform, and their loyalty to it so as to make proper suggestions to the service providers to improve their service.With literature reading, the research model in this study consists of three parts: the initial variables constituted by interactions between bloggers and their readers, intermediate variables consisting of bloggers'satisfaction with the platform and the outcomes variables consisting of bloggers'loyalty to the platform.Relevant data that is necessary to this study is obtained from over 200 questionnaires to blog writers, and the result indicates verification of the idea of this study. Main conclusions come as follows:1. The interaction has some positive influence on bloggers'satisfaction. In details, two kinds of interaction between bloggers and their friends (review and comment, leaving a website mail letter) obviously has a positive influence on their satisfaction, so does the interaction between bloggers and strangers (review and comment), while a stranger's website mail letter has no influence on their satisfaction.2. Bloggers'satisfaction influences their loyalty to a particular platform in a positive way.3. The interaction influences bloggers'loyalty in some way. In details, two kinds of interaction between bloggers and their friends (review and comment, leaving a website mail letter) obviously has a positive influence on their loyalty, so does the interaction between bloggers and strangers (review and comment), while a stranger's website mail letter has no influence on their loyalty.4.There is a certain difference between different bloggers.Suggestions and research orientation are put forward in the end of this study.
